Boca Raton Office Building Could Be Redeveloped

February 1, 2026/in News/by admin

A long-standing office property in Boca Raton may be repositioned as a mixed-use residential project under Florida’s Live Local Act.

ZNT LLC, led by Jeffrey Levitetz of Boca Raton-based Bark Property Management, has submitted an application to amend the master plan for an 8-acre site at 5300 Broken Sound Blvd. NW. The request would allow the existing office property to be redeveloped into a multifamily and retail project utilizing Live Local Act provisions.

The site is part of a broader master-planned area that previously included a neighboring 297-unit apartment community at 5400 Broken Sound Blvd. NW, now known as Amalta Broken Sound. ZNT LLC sold that parcel in 2019 to affiliates of Related Group and Rockpoint Group, which completed the development in 2022. The property was sold later that year for $194 million, underscoring the strength of the Boca Raton multifamily market.

ZNT LLC now controls the remaining parcel, which currently contains a 58,614-square-foot office building dating back to 1982. According to online listings, nearly all of the office space is presently available for lease.

Under the Live Local Act, developers may build multifamily projects at the maximum height and density allowed within a municipality if a portion of the units are designated as workforce housing. While the state law generally requires 40% of units to meet workforce housing thresholds, Boca Raton has adopted a local ordinance allowing projects to qualify with as little as 10%.

Plans for the Broken Sound Boulevard site call for a seven-story development with 191 residential units, supported by a five-story parking garage with 420 spaces. The proposal also includes two retail buildings totaling 31,000 square feet, along with 230 surface parking spaces dedicated to retail use. Of the residential units, 19 would be reserved for households earning up to 120% of area median income, and 10 units would serve households earning up to 140% of area median income.

Preliminary plans identify two retail spaces as potential grocery and emergency room uses, though no tenants have been formally announced. The project was designed by Boca Raton-based HDA Architects.

While several Live Local Act proposals have been submitted in Boca Raton, none have begun construction to date. The first Live Local Act project combining workforce and market-rate housing to break ground in the region is located in nearby Boynton Beach.

IPA Brokers Office Asset Sale In Palm Beach County

January 25, 2026/in Done Deals, News/by admin

Institutional Property Advisors (IPA) announced the sale of the PGA Design Center, a 43,878-square-foot professional building located within PGA Station, a mixed-use development in Palm Beach Gardens.

The property sold for $15.5 million.

“Located in one of South Florida’s most affluent and supply-constrained markets, the property benefits from long-term tenancy, strong lease commitments, and the demand drivers of a master-planned environment that integrates office, medical, retail and hospitality,” said Douglas Mandel, IPA executive managing director investments.

Mandel, along with Zach Levine and Cody Hershey of Marcus & Millichap represented the seller, PGA Design Partners LP, with support from the Falk Weprin team at Colliers. The Marcus & Millichap team, in collaboration with Colliers executive vice president Scott Weprin, sourced the purchaser, LRP Properties 3901 LLC.

The property is just off RCA Boulevard, close to PGA Boulevard, and Interstate 95. The Gardens Mall, Downtown at the Gardens, and the PGA National Resort and Spa are nearby.

Within a three-mile radius, the population is over 79,000 and the annual median income is more than $439,000.

Built in 2006, the PGA Design Center’s tenants are New Radiance Cosmetic Centers, Score At The Top Learning Centers and Schools, and Outside the Box Coastal Home Furnishings. At the time of the sale, the center was 100% occupied.

Pembroke Pines Office Property Trades, More Than Triples In Value

January 18, 2026/in Done Deals, News/by admin

An office property in western Broward County recently sold, reflecting continued investment activity in the region’s commercial real estate market.

The Edison Pembroke Pines, located at 1200-1300 Southwest 145th Avenue, sold for $44.5 million. Spanning nearly 263,000 square feet, the transaction equates to approximately $170 per square foot.

The seller was Pembroke 145 Office LLC, an affiliate of TPA Group, which originally acquired the property in 2017 for $12.2 million.

The buyer was an LLC tied to Midtown Capital Partners. The acquisition underscores ongoing interest from local capital groups seeking scale and long-term positioning within the South Florida office market.

In April 2025, Comcast settled into a 28,890-square-foot space at the property, vacating 63,850 square feet at 789 International Parkway in Sunrise.

Despite broader shifts in office demand nationwide, transactions of this size suggest that investors continue to pursue well-located, institutional-quality office properties in the region.

Vision Real Estate Advisors Completes Sale Of Boca Office Building For $800 PSF

January 12, 2026/in Done Deals, News/by admin

Vision Real Estate Advisors’ Managing Directors Elon Gerberg and Adam H. Klein announced the successful closing of the Boca Raton Executive Offices.

Located at the high-visibility corner of Yamato Road and Highway 441 in Boca Raton, Boca Raton Executive Offices, a  11,300-square-foot office building, sold for $5,750,000, or approximately $800 per square foot.

Demonstrating the firm’s brokerage expertise, the deal closed as-is with no inspections in just 30 days.

“This property sat on the market for an entire year before we were awarded the listing,” said Adam H. Klein, Managing Director at Vision Real Estate Advisors. “Once engaged, we generated nearly 10 offers and moved to a swift 30-day closing. This result proves that capital remains incredibly aggressive for quality, high-visibility assets in South Florida.”

Palm Beach County Suburban Office Market Heats-Up

January 7, 2026/in News, Trends/by admin

Downtown West Palm Beach’s office market is thriving—but rising rents are making it harder for some longtime tenants to keep a foothold in the city core.

The surge is largely fueled by billionaire developer Stephen Ross, whose aggressive investment and development strategy has helped transform downtown West Palm into one of South Florida’s most competitive office markets. His projects have drawn a steady stream of high-profile tenants and helped accelerate the city and county’s long-term growth vision.

That momentum, however, has driven rents sharply higher across downtown, including in buildings Ross does not own. As a result, some established tenants are being priced out and are relocating to suburban areas of Palm Beach County, where new office development is beginning to follow demand.

One notable example is law firm Lytal, Reiter, Smith, Ivey & Fronrath, which last year moved most of its operations from the Northbridge Centre in downtown West Palm—where it had leased space for roughly 40 years—to Palm Beach Gardens. The firm cited renewal proposals that were several times higher than its previous rent, reflecting what some tenants describe as unsustainable downtown pricing.

According to local brokers, asking rents in excess of $100 per square foot are prompting more companies to explore suburban alternatives. That shift is helping spark new office construction outside the urban core.

In Palm Beach Gardens, Gatsby Florida—an affiliate of Gatsby Enterprises—is planning The Modern, an eight-story, 220,000-square-foot office building with a six-story parking garage at 11200 RCA Center Drive. The project, expected to deliver in 2027, is being positioned in part to attract out-of-state firms and executives relocating to South Florida. Gatsby acquired the site for $17.5 million in 2022.

Meanwhile, in Boca Raton, construction is underway on The Aletto, a two-building office campus totaling 140,000 square feet that is already approximately 60 percent pre-leased.

Developers and brokers say these projects reflect growing demand for high-quality suburban office space that offers modern amenities without downtown pricing.

Ross, who launched Related Ross after stepping back from New York-based Related Companies in 2024, has made downtown West Palm the centerpiece of his development focus. His portfolio includes roughly a dozen office buildings in various stages, along with residential, hotel, and mixed-use projects.

By leveraging longstanding relationships—particularly within the financial services sector—Ross quickly filled many of his office properties with out-of-state tenants. More recently, his firm has also pushed to position Palm Beach County as an emerging technology hub.

While downtown West Palm continues to gain national attention, the ripple effects of its success are reshaping the broader county office market—creating new opportunities, but also new challenges, for tenants navigating the region’s rapid growth.

First Trophy Office Project In 25 Years Breaks Ground In Boca Raton

December 28, 2025/in News/by admin

Compson Associates, together with Alfredo Aletto, announced the groundbreaking of The Aletto, a landmark Class-A mixed-use office and lifestyle destination set in the heart of Downtown Boca Raton at Sanborn Square.

Representing Compson Associates, Inc., is the Colliers team—Executive Vice Presidents Scott Brenner, Gary A. Gottlieb, Derek Baker, Jonathan Carter, Dave Preston, and Vice President Marc Fechter—who are leading the marketing and leasing efforts for the office and retail portions of the project.

“We are so thrilled to be part of this exciting project and work alongside Carl Klepper and Bobby D’Angelo, who had the vision for this transformative and iconic project,” said Brenner.

Designed to redefine the professional and cultural landscape of the city, The Aletto will feature 140,000 square feet of premier office, retail, and hospitality space, including:

  • Two state-of-the-art office towers offering panoramic views
  • A signature “open to the public” 10th-floor rooftop restaurant with indoor-outdoor dining and skyline vistas
  • Luxury amenities including a private fitness center, steam & sauna, valet parking, and a full-time concierge service

Strategically located steps from Mizner Park, Brightline’s Boca Raton Station, and the city’s thriving dining and retail corridor, The Aletto is poised to become Downtown Boca’s first trophy-class office development in more than 25 years.

The Aletto will feature a brand-new 550-car parking garage seamlessly integrated into the development, offering ample capacity for office tenants, retail patrons, and restaurant guests. Featuring valet service, controlled access, and efficient circulation, the garage is designed to maximize convenience while minimizing traffic impact on surrounding streets. Its strategic layout ensures easy ingress and egress, enhancing overall accessibility to Downtown Boca and supporting the project’s vision of a walkable, vibrant urban destination.

Compson Associates has partnered with NADG to advance and elevate The Aletto, combining deep local expertise with national development capabilities to deliver a best-in-class project. This partnership reflects a shared commitment to creating a transformative destination in Downtown Boca. To support the project’s execution, the development team intends to utilize Bank of the Ozarks for the first mortgage, securing a strong financial foundation that positions The Aletto for timely delivery and long-term success.
